Gå til innhold

Musikk-anbefalings program / skript


DrDoogie

Anbefalte innlegg

Ok, saken er da den at jeg for tiden driver og mekker på et lite perl-skript som tar sikte på å anbefale musikk til folk.

 

I den sammenheng ønsker jeg kontakt med folk som:

1. Har samlinger med HELE cd'er av musikk

2. Kan liste samlingen sin i en fil, med formatet "artist<TAB>album"

 

[sE EDIT]Interesserte kan sende PM[/sE EDIT], eventuellt komme med spørsmål her.

Foreløpig er dette på planleggingsstadiet, og jeg nevner det her for å få litt tilbakemelding.

 

Sånn rent konseptuelt sett er tanken å ta utgangspunkt i X antall samlinger av musikk, for å finne fellestrekk og kunne anbefale disse.

 

Eksempler:

Mange som har cd'er av Enya har også cd'er av Kate Bush, mange som har cd'er av Mike Oldfield har også av Vangelis, Jean-Michell Jarre etc.

 

Dette er tenkt å, med tid og stunder, å legges opp på en web-side, hvor jeg vil gjøre mitt ytterste for å unngå reklame-bannere etc.

 

EDIT:

Dårlig løsning å foreslå at alle skulle sende meg PM.

Skriv heller bare kort 'interessert, <CD_ANTALL>' i denne tråden.

 

Eksempelvis:

interessert, 200

 

EDIT 2:

Oppdatering:

Har kommet langt nok til å velge å opprette en tråd (her) som tar sikte på å svare på tekniske spørsmål.

Endret av DrDoogie
Lenke til kommentar
Videoannonse
Annonse
Er det samma f HVOR mange plater det er snakk om? alt over 30 stk holder?

Vel, jo igrunnen.

 

For å greie ut litt mer (tenker her på Venn-diagrammer), hvis man har en mengde cd'er (kall mengden / settet 'A'), så vil man med X antall mengder få sterkere og sterkere overlapp på enkelte 'subset' (hvor subset da er "artister som forekommer i samlinger hvor samlingen innehar artist 'Y').

 

Kanskje jeg formulerer meg litt stokkete her.

Uansett, dette er ment å være en etterlysning etter interesserte beta-testere / bidragsytere til en database hvor kluet er å kunne anbefale cd'er basert på hva folk som har cd 'Z' også har av musikk.

 

Så alle som er interessert i å bidra er seff velkommne.

 

Igjen, dette er foreløpig kun på planleggings-stadium.

 

[sE ØVERSTE POST FOR EDIT]For dem som er interesserte, er det bare å sende en PM[/sE ØVERSTE POST FOR EDIT], så kan dem kontaktes når det blir aktuellt. Det vil nok minst ta tre uker før bidrag ettersøkes.

 

Og igjen, ingen, inkludert meg, kommer til å tjene penger på dette.

I verste fall (hvis en eventuell hjemmesnekkra server ikke takler belastningen ved folks forespørsler om anbefalinger), så kan det ferdige skriptet m/ database legges på en eller annen not-for-profit server.

 

Mange mulige løsninger der.

Endret av DrDoogie
Lenke til kommentar

Fikk spørsmål på PM, svarer her.

 

hvis jeg for eksempel har to album: metallica - master of puppets og D.D.E - Vi e konga

så skal jeg skrive det slik i ei .txt fil:

metallica<TAB>master of puppets

D.D.E<TAB>Vi e konga

 

?

eller tar jeg feil

 

Med <TAB> så mener jeg tabulator. Innrykks-tasten på tastaturet.

Selv foretrekker jeg å skille felter / entries / "forskjellige data" med tab, fordi det er uhyre sjelden at det tegnet forekommer i data fra freedb. Og fordi det er så raskt å se at man har skilt tekst som skal skilles, ved bruk av tabulator.

 

Vi snakker da om:

artistnavn        albumnavn

Lenke til kommentar
DrDoogie: Når kan vi forvente oss dette, da? Jeg kom forresten ut av tellingen...

Vel, jeg lastet nettopp ned postgresql 7.4.1., som jeg tenker å bruke i grunn.

Nå skal jeg lese lisensbetingelsene, mens jeg kompilerer db'en, dernest testing, så skal jeg skrive tabellene, dernest triggerne...

 

Det er ferdig når det er ferdig (hvis det blir ferdig, da), ellers er det bare å være tålmodig.

Lenke til kommentar

Ja forresten - interessert, 700

 

Edit :

Eiriksen: Det er vel best om du kun regner de du har kjøpt, for de er antageligvis de du føler mest for. De du ikke har kjøpt, kun lastet ned, betyr sannsynligvis ikke så mye for deg og dermed er de ikke så interessante i anbefalingsskriptet heller?

Endret av Kowalski
Lenke til kommentar
Er det cder jeg har kjøpt og lasta ned? Eller bare kjøpt?

Det er snakk om cd'er du (jeg, eller rettere: mitt skript) kan identifisere gjennom freedb.

 

I praksis vil nok dette si >95% av alle cd'er.

 

Allikevel må man regne med at ikke alle "artist<TAB>album" linjer blir gjenkjent. Men den tid, den sorg.

 

EDIT:

^^^ Godt poeng.

Endret av DrDoogie
Lenke til kommentar
Er det cder jeg har kjøpt og lasta ned? Eller bare kjøpt?

Det er snakk om cd'er du (jeg, eller rettere: mitt skript) kan identifisere gjennom freedb.

 

I praksis vil nok dette si >95% av alle cd'er.

 

Allikevel må man regne med at ikke alle "artist<TAB>album" linjer blir gjenkjent. Men den tid, den sorg.

 

EDIT:

^^^ Godt poeng.

Jeg kan ta de jeg har kjøpt og de jeg har lastet ned som jeg føler mest for. Vil ikke ta de eldste cdene jeg har kjøpt, for de har jeg stuet vekk i skam. :blush:

 

Edit Intressert, 40-45

Endret av eiriksen
Lenke til kommentar

Vil det ikke være et poeng at eierne sier noe om hvorvidt de synes albumet var et godt kjøp eller ikke ? Evt om de sier noe om hvilke album de aller minst kan klare seg uten.

 

Og - vil det ikke være bedre jo MINDRE samlingene er - med stigende albumantall øker jo delmengden av totalmengden slik at sannsynligheten for at et hvilket som helst album finnes med øker. Større albumsamling KAN jo også tyde på ukritisk kjøp/ evt samlermani i forhold til sjangere/artister eller for velfylt lommebok.

Lenke til kommentar
Vil det ikke være et poeng at eierne sier noe om hvorvidt de synes albumet var et godt kjøp eller ikke ?

Og - vil det ikke være bedre jo MINDRE samlingene er...

Jeg er enig. Poenget med scriptet er vel å gi en viss pekepinn på hva en person som likte albumet X liker ellers, slik at hvis en annen person er ute etter et album, og liker X får vite hva andre liker, omfg forklaring.

 

My point is... Jeg har kjøpt CD-er som jeg er misfornøyd med, og hvis det er en person som for eksempel har alle Tool-CD-ene er ute etter et nytt album å kjøpe, og ser at jeg har alle de óg Godsmack - Faceless, tror han kanskje at det er noe for ham. Hvilket det selvsagt ikke er!

God natt

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
  • Hvem er aktive   0 medlemmer

    • Ingen innloggede medlemmer aktive
×
×
  • Opprett ny...